Saudi Minister of Trade and Industry Dr. Hashem Yamani, declared on Saturday the launch of the Emaar (construction) economic city public shareholding company with a caputal of SR8.5 billion US$ 2.3 billion.
According to him, the capital of the Jeddah-based company is divided into 850 million shares at the nominal value of ten Saudi Riyals per share, noting that the founders of the company has subscribed by 595 million shares representing 70 percent of the company's capital.
He pointed out that the goal of the company is to develop real estate and reclaimed lands, and other lands in the special economic zones or in others, considered for mixed use or further development.
